  • Publication number: 20210295557
    Abstract: An apparatus and method for position determination in a 3D model of an environment and a computer-executed iterative method for position determination in a 3D model of an environment. The method includes the steps of: a) acquisition of camera, gyroscope and accelerometer data, b) determination of visual features from the acquired camera sensor data, c) creation of a current key image of the pose (PK) from the visual features and the gyroscope and accelerometer sensor data, d) addition of the key image of the pose (PK) to a database, and e) position determination by comparing the current key image of the posture (PK) with those of the database.
